15 Garage Entryway Ideas To Maximize Functionality

Check out these 15 cool garage entryway ideas that combine style and functionality to create the perfect welcoming transition into your home! It’s a space that should be as functional as it is inviting, offering convenience for daily routines while keeping clutter at bay. Whether it’s adding a mudroom bench or installing practical storage solutions, these small changes can make a big impact. With the right combination of smart organization and design, your garage entryway can be transformed from a simple pass-through into a highly efficient and welcoming space.

1. Add a Mudroom Bench

mudroom bench near the garage entryway

A mudroom bench near the garage entryway provides a convenient place to sit while putting on or removing shoes. It also adds storage with cubbies or baskets underneath, perfect for organizing shoes, bags, and sports gear. Whether built-in or freestanding, a bench helps keep the area tidy and functional. Plus, it adds a welcoming touch to an often-overlooked space, making it feel more connected to the home’s interior.

2. Install Hooks for Coats and Bags

install hooks for coats and bags in entryway

Incorporating hooks along the wall of your garage entryway makes it easy to hang coats, bags, and even hats. This solution is not only practical for organizing everyday essentials but also helps prevent clutter from accumulating on floors or counters. Sturdy hooks can handle heavier items like backpacks or winter gear, keeping everything in reach as you head in or out. The sleek design also complements various home styles, adding both function and style.

3. Use Durable Flooring

durable flooring for garage entryway

Installing durable flooring, such as tile, vinyl, or epoxy, is a smart choice. These materials are easy to clean and resistant to wear and tear, ensuring the area stays looking fresh despite the heavy use. Opt for slip-resistant options to enhance safety, especially in wet or snowy weather. The right flooring can blend seamlessly with the rest of your home's decor while standing up to daily use.

4. Create a Drop Zone for Keys and Mail

drop zone for keys and mail

A dedicated drop zone near the garage door can keep daily essentials like keys, mail, and wallets neatly organized. Install a small shelf or wall-mounted tray to hold these items, ensuring they’re easy to grab when needed. This simple addition eliminates the common frustration of misplaced keys and creates an organized entryway. Adding a small bowl or decorative tray can enhance the aesthetic appeal while keeping clutter at bay.

5. Incorporate Shoe Storage

shoe storage for garage entryway

Keeping shoes organized in the garage entryway is essential for reducing clutter and maintaining cleanliness in your home. Use shoe racks, cubbies, or even built-in storage to neatly arrange footwear. This not only provides a dedicated spot for shoes but also prevents dirt and debris from being tracked into the house. Consider adjustable shelving for larger families or different seasons, so everyone has a place to store their shoes.

6. Add a Rug or Mat for Dirt Control

entryway rug for dirt control

Placing a durable rug or mat inside the garage entryway helps trap dirt and moisture before it enters your home. Choose a heavy-duty, washable rug that can withstand foot traffic and the elements. This small addition can make a big difference in keeping floors clean and extending the life of your interior flooring. A rug with a non-slip backing also adds a layer of safety, reducing the risk of slipping in wet conditions.

7. Install Overhead Shelving

overhead shelving for garage entryway

If floor space is limited near your garage entryway, consider adding overhead shelving for extra storage. High shelves provide a place to store less frequently used items, like seasonal decor, tools, or sports equipment, without cluttering the floor. This maximizes vertical space and keeps the area clear, creating a more organized and spacious entryway. Opt for adjustable shelving systems for flexibility as storage needs change.

8. Add a Charging Station

charging station for garage entryway

Incorporating a charging station into your garage entryway can be a game-changer for busy households. Install outlets and a small counter or shelf where phones, tablets, and other devices can be charged before heading out. This not only ensures that devices are always ready to go but also keeps cords organized and out of sight. A charging station offers convenience while keeping technology in one dedicated spot near the entrance.

9. Paint an Accent Wall

painted accent wall for entryway

Transform your garage entryway by painting an accent wall in a bold or contrasting color. This easy update brings a fresh, inviting look to the space, adding character without overwhelming it. Choose a color that complements your home’s palette but stands out enough to create visual interest. It’s a simple way to give the entryway personality and style, making it feel more like an extension of your living space.

10. Use Pegboards for Organization

entryway pegboards for organization

Pegboards offer versatile storage solutions for the garage entryway. By adding hooks, baskets, and shelves, you can create a customized system that keeps tools, accessories, or sporting goods neatly organized and easily accessible. Pegboards make it simple to adjust the layout as your needs change and help keep the floor space clear. This functional yet stylish addition can turn the entryway into a highly efficient storage hub.

11. Incorporate Bright Lighting

bright lighting for garage entryway

Ample lighting is essential in a garage entryway to ensure safety and functionality. Installing bright overhead lighting or wall-mounted fixtures helps illuminate the space, especially during nighttime or early morning hours. Opt for LED bulbs for energy efficiency and longevity. A well-lit entryway makes it easier to find keys, shoes, or bags and creates a welcoming environment when entering the home from the garage.

12. Add a Mirror for Last-Minute Checks

entryway mirror for last minute check

Hanging a mirror near the garage entryway offers both practical and aesthetic benefits. It allows for quick outfit or appearance checks before leaving the house, and it can make the space feel larger and brighter by reflecting light. A stylish mirror frame can also enhance the overall design of the area, adding a touch of sophistication to what is often a utilitarian space.

13. Create a Pet Zone

create a pet zone for entryway

If you have pets, dedicating a portion of the garage entryway to their needs can be incredibly convenient. Install hooks for leashes, bins for toys, and a spot for food and water bowls. This setup keeps pet essentials organized and ready for walks or outings. For larger animals, consider adding a built-in feeding station or pet bed to make the space more pet-friendly while staying clutter-free.

14. Use Wall-Mounted Baskets

wall mounted baskets for the entryway

Wall-mounted baskets are a great way to add flexible storage to a garage entryway. These baskets can hold anything from hats and gloves to dog leashes and sports gear, keeping everything organized yet accessible. Choose wire or woven baskets for a stylish look that complements the rest of the entryway decor. By getting items off the floor and into designated spaces, the entryway feels more open and less cluttered.

15. Personalize with Family Photos or Artwork

personalize garage with family photos or artwork

Make the garage entryway more inviting by adding personal touches like family photos or artwork. Hanging framed pictures or decorative art pieces gives the area a warm, personalized feel and makes it a welcoming transition into the home. This unexpected touch transforms a typically overlooked space into one that reflects your family’s personality, turning it into a meaningful part of your home's design.

Conclusion:

By incorporating these garage entryway ideas, you can create a space that seamlessly blends practicality with style. From efficient storage solutions like wall-mounted baskets and hooks to personalized touches such as family photos, every detail works to make this area both functional and welcoming. With the right mix of durable materials, smart lighting, and thoughtful organization, your garage entryway can become a streamlined extension of your home, helping keep your everyday life running smoothly.

Key Takeaways:

  1. Functional Seating: Add a mudroom bench to provide seating and storage for shoes, bags, and other essentials.
  2. Efficient Organization: Use hooks, wall-mounted baskets, and pegboards for coats, bags, and accessories to prevent clutter.
  3. Durable Materials: Install durable, easy-to-clean flooring like tile or epoxy to withstand heavy foot traffic.
  4. Lighting and Visibility: Ensure bright lighting for safety and convenience, especially during early mornings or late nights.
  5. Storage Solutions: Maximize space with overhead shelving and designated drop zones for keys, mail, and electronics.
  6. Personalized Design: Use accent walls, family photos, or mirrors to create an inviting, personalized entryway.
  7. Pet-Friendly Features: Design a pet zone for leashes, toys, and feeding stations to accommodate your furry friends.
